Heavy Duty Electric Wheelchair

Motorized wheelchairs or powered wheelchairs offer you the freedom to explore the world and move around independently. They are suitable for both indoor and outdoor environments as well as on rough terrain.

Weight Capacity

When looking for a heavy duty power wheelchair, it is important to take into consideration the capacity to support your weight. This will ensure that the chair is able to help you with your weight while ensuring an enjoyable ride. You should also look for a wheelchair with a large capacity battery. This will allow the chair to travel a significant distance on a single charge.

A power wheelchair that is heavy-duty is a chair with a higher capacity for weight than a standard electric wheelchair. These chairs are designed to fit users who weigh 300 or more pounds. They are typically built with durable frames and components to ensure they are able to withstand the extra weight. Heavy-duty power wheelchairs are available in front-wheel drive and rear-wheel drive models. Front-wheel drive wheelchairs are generally more maneuverable and have tighter turning radius, while rear-wheel drive models offer greater stability on uneven surfaces.

Stability

When using a heavy-duty electric wheelchair, the stability of the chair is key to its effectiveness. A chair that isn't stable could cause discomfort and loss of control or even injury to the user. Stability is achieved through a variety of factors, including weight capacity, chassis design and drive system, as well as suspension.

Designed with larger, more substantial users in mind, the heavy-duty power chairs are constructed to support a larger amount of weight, without compromising the frame structure and drive components. They are also designed to tackle a wider variety of terrains while offering an easier ride.

The most important aspect of the stability of a chair is the center of mass. This determines how the chair reacts to changes in the environment like an incline or a slope. To test the durability of a wheelchair, researchers used a robot wheelchair referred to as Mobility Enhancement Robotic Wheelchair (MEBot). MEBot was driven up and down a slope of 20 degrees in front-wheel drive mode. The center of mass position was determined by analysing the angles of its seat and rear caster joints on a force plate.

The results of the MEBot study reveal that the wheelchair has high stability when driving up the slope. This is due in part to the fact the wheelchair's mass center stays within the space of the wheelchair which prevents tipping. When the wheelchair is driving downhill, the mass shifts closer to its front, which reduces the sideways stability margin. This can be overcome by lowering the front casters of the wheelchair to increase the stability margin or by reducing the speed limit to ensure safety. The stability of the wheelchair could be enhanced by evenly distributing the weight and belongings of the person and their belongings across the chair. To prevent the chair from over-taxing its components, the weight of any personal belongings should be limited to the manufacturer's specified maximum weight capacity. Doing this can aid in maintaining stability and extend the lifespan of the chair.

Battery Life

Several factors influence the total lifespan of a power wheelchair battery. These include battery health (the condition and age of the battery and also the user's weight) and the frequency with which the wheelchair is used. The type of terrain the wheelchair is used on will also have a significant impact on the battery's lifespan. The wheelchair must perform more difficult work on sandy, rough, and muddy surfaces, which can drain its battery faster.

It is a good idea to purchase another battery if you use your wheelchair frequently. This will allow you to relax in your chair and not worry about whether you have enough power for each journey. Additionally, regular cleaning of the chair as well as proper charging practices are suggested. It is essential to not let the battery run out completely. It is also an excellent idea to schedule regular checks with a professional, as this helps identify problems early and prevents them from getting worse.

The amount of time a battery is connected to a power source can also have a significant impact on its lifespan. The process of sulfation in batteries can happen when a battery remains connected for long periods of time. These conditions can lead to a drastic reduction in battery life.

The most common wheelchair type is the front-wheel model. It has big wheels in front and uses them for movement. These types of wheelchairs can turn in tight spaces and work well indoors. However, they might not be able to go over bumps or at high speeds outside.

Another alternative is the rear-wheel drive electric wheelchair. They are more stable and cope with rough surfaces. However, they might not be as quick or capable of making sharp turns as front-wheel drive wheelchairs.

There are also hybrid wheelchairs, that combine rear-wheel and front-wheel drive systems. These models are versatile and can be used both indoors and outdoors, but they may not be able to handle the steep inclines or slopes like other types of electric wheelchairs.
